- Honda (NYSE:HMC) says it built more vehicles in the U.S. to sell locally than it imported from Japan for the first time in its history last year.
- The automaker's production in the U.S. rose 7.4%.
- Cars built by Honda in the U.S. also ended up being sold in 50 different nations including Russia and several in the Middle East.
